http://www.njcrib.com/ WebOverview. The New Jersey Supreme Court is the state’s highest appellate court. Supreme Court decisions and oral arguments help lay the foundation for interpreting and applying state laws. The chief justice and six associate justices compose the Supreme Court. They are responsible for reviewing cases from the lower courts.

WebBill Title: Authorizes creation of local civilian review boards to review police operations and conduct; appropriates $600,000.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Democrat 5-0) Status: (Introduced - Dead) 2024-09-24 - Introduced in the Senate, Referred to Senate Law and Public Safety Committee [S2963 Detail] Download: New_Jersey-2024-S2963-Introduced.html.
